Tuition Fees in Colleges
Colleges in Sichuan province typically charge tuition fees based on the specific institution, program of study, and sometimes the student's residency status. Tuition fees for colleges can vary widely depending on whether the institution is a public or private university, as well as factors such as prestige and academic reputation.
Tuition Fees in Vocational Schools
Similarly, tuition fees for vocational schools in Sichuan province can also vary depending on the institution and the program of study. Vocational schools often offer specialized training in areas such as technology, trade skills, and practical professions. The tuition fees for vocational schools may be structured differently from those of colleges, as vocational education tends to focus more on practical training and skills development.
Comparison of Tuition Fees
While there may be some overlap in tuition fees between colleges and vocational schools in Sichuan province, it is not accurate to say that they are always the same. Colleges may have higher tuition fees due to factors such as research facilities, faculty epertise, and academic resources, while vocational schools may prioritize hands-on training and industry connections.
Factors Influencing Tuition Fees
Several factors can influence tuition fees in both colleges and vocational schools in Sichuan province. These factors may include government subsidies, student enrollment numbers, program demand, and the overall economic climate. Additionally, scholarships, financial aid, and other forms of assistance may be available to help offset the cost of tuition for eligible students.
